
‘Some writers talk the talk, but Roger Price walks the walk.’ Stephen Leather Detective Sergeant Martin Draker is a seasoned officer who clears cases - and not always through conventional methods. A reliable informant, Abdul Bashir, tells Draker that a corrupt police official is passing sensitive intelligence to criminal Dan Manning, a vicious Manchester armed robber and drug dealer, who is also importing heroin from India. Abdul Bashir then goes missing. Field analyst Cath Moore, a former journalist who switched careers to join police intelligence, is investigating an upsurge in deaths caused by a new drug – Sky White. Manning commits an armed robbery and leaves a body in the burnt-out getaway car. Draker fears it is the missing informant, Bashir. A note threatens more deaths unless the police cease their investigation. Moore launches a TV appeal warning of the dangers of Sky White. Manning is incensed; she could kill the new drug’s market before the supplier makes a return on his investment. Draker and Moore pursue Manning, who in turn is hunting Moore to silence her. An audacious plan to capture Manning fails, only for Draker and Moore to run into Manning's own trap. Roger A.
